Bonnie J. Taylor began working at Health for Humanity in February, 1995, and served for 12 years. The majority of that service was in the role of financial coordinator. She returned to Health for Humanity in 2013. Bonnie has a Bachelor of Arts from Northeastern Illinois University. She a devoted advocate for race unity and Baha'i principles and is the compiler of three publications, including The Power of Unity: Beyond Prejudice and Racism (in collaboration with the National Race Unity Committee), The Pupil of the Eye: African Americans in the World Order of Baha'u'llah, and One Reality: The Harmony of Science and Religion. She lives with her husband in Wadsworth, Illinois.
